Over the course of
the civilized human history, there have been a number of philosophers,
saints and social and religious leaders around the world who have pondered
over the meaning of life, the nature of truth, the existence of God, the
ethical code of conduct, intricacies of human emotions and other
intriguing questions. Their answers vary depending upon their religious
beliefs, national origin and the time period in which they lived. It is
unusual to find one book, written by one person that has explored almost
all aspects of life and arrived at conclusions that are universally and
eternally valid. Thiruvalluvar lived about 2000 years ago in Tamil Nadu,
meaning the land of Tamils, currently one of the states in the southern
part of India. Thiruvalluvar was a unique genius who wrote the book called
Muppaal, later known as Thirukkural which has been hailed by many as the
greatest gift to mankind.
In many respects,
Thiruvalluvar is more comprehensive and covers the whole spectrum of human
experiences than the well-known philosophers like Buddha, Confucius,
Aristotle, Plato, Machiavelli and others. In spite of the remarkable
nature of his contribution, Thiruvalluvar is relatively unknown outside
his native land.
